NTN Registration for Partnerships (AOPs)
What is an Association of Persons (AOP)?
An Association of Persons (AOP) refers to a group of individuals or entities who come together for a common purpose, such as conducting business or joint ventures. AOPs can include partnerships, joint ventures, and other similar arrangements.
How to Obtain an NTN for AOPs?
E-Enrollment with FBR:
- Visit the Federal Board of Revenue (FBR) website.
- Click on “e-Registration.”
- Select “New e-Registration” and choose “Company” as the taxpayer type.
- Fill in the online form with the required information.
- Upload scanned copies of the necessary documents, including valid CNICs of each partner, rent agreement, ownership documents of the office place, and the latest paid utility bill1.
Required Documents for AOP NTN:
- Unique name for the AOP.
- All members (partners) must be registered with FBR and have NTN.
- Rent agreement.
- Copy of the latest paid utility bill.
- Form C (in case of a registered partnership)2.
Benefits of Proper AOP NTN Registration:
- Legally compliant status.
- Access to the Iris portal for online tax filing.
- Eligibility for tax benefits and exemptions.
- Facilitates business transactions and financial dealings
NTN Registration for Companies
What is a Company?
A company is a separate legal entity formed under the Companies Act. It can be a private limited company, a public limited company, or any other corporate structure.
How to Obtain an NTN for Companies?
E-Enrollment with FBR:
- Visit the FBR website.
- Click on “e-Registration.”
- Choose “Company” as the taxpayer type.
- Provide the required information and upload relevant documents.
- Receive a 7-digit NTN after e-enrollment3.
Required Documents for Company NTN:
- Company registration documents.
- Memorandum and Articles of Association.
- Proof of office address.
- CNICs of directors and shareholders.
- Other relevant documents.
Benefits of Proper Company NTN Registration:
- Legal recognition and compliance.
- Access to the Iris portal for tax-related activities.
- Facilitates business operations and financial transactions.
- Enables tax planning and optimization.
